About The Position

The Academic Success Center (ASC) promotes undergraduate retention and persistence efforts through data-informed student success initiatives including tutoring services, course assessment and placement, faculty and peer mentoring, college transition courses, and student leadership opportunities. This university-wide student success unit endeavors to cultivate, support, and celebrate academic excellence for students across all disciplines at the University of Oklahoma. The Administrative Support Specialist offers administrative support to the Administrative Office of the Academic Success Center.
